I've been using Tiger and Leopard Cache Cleaners for a long time and when the software asks for an admin password, I type my password so the software can do several tasks to tidy up and optimise my Macbook.
I do not understand why some users have issues with using an admin password but a password seems a small price to pay so that no one unwarranted is mucking up your computer. The gains far outweigh the extra step.
I actually use a handful of utilities for maintenance and I think that's a good idea because Leopard Cache Cleaner has features others do not have. If there is any redundancy, that's acceptable for the unique features it has.
